Trump is ready to speak in the Ukrainian parliament: what the US president said.
According to ТСН: US President Donald Trump announced his readiness to visit Ukraine and speak before the Ukrainian parliament.
This information was voiced at a joint press conference following the conclusion of negotiations.
In response to a question about a possible visit to Ukraine in the event of a peace agreement, Trump indicated that there are currently no specific plans and his main goal is to reach an agreement. However, he did not rule out the possibility of his visit.
“I suggested going and speaking in their parliament. If that helps. I don't know if it will help. I think it probably will help, but I don't even know,” Trump said.
Ukrainian President Volodymyr Zelensky confirmed that Trump would be welcome in Ukraine if he makes such a decision.
“I’m not sure it will actually be necessary, but if it helps save 25,000 lives a month or however many, I will definitely be ready to do it,” Trump said.
It was also noted that negotiations between Trump and Zelensky will continue in the coming days.
